The Women’s & Children’s Hospital Foundation (WCH Foundation) improves the health and wellbeing of women, children and families under the care of the Women’s and Children’s Hospital and its associated Health Network.
The WCH Foundation relies on generous contributions from the community to fund initiatives that support clinical care like our ‘Laklinyeri’ Beach House, deliver programs such as our extensive Arts in Health program, support the purchase of state-of-the-art medical equipment, provide immediate emergency support to families in need, and invest in vital medical research.
Our ongoing support has a lasting impact on the health and wellbeing of children and families who rely on the services of the Hospital and Women’s and Children’s Health Network. Our support reaches families all over South Australia, as well as families from the Northern Territory, Broken Hill and the Sunraysia Region of Victoria who need to travel to the WCH for specialist treatment.
Your Women’s and Children’s Health Network
The Women’s and Children’s Health Network (WCHN) is South Australia’s leading provider of specialty care and health services for women, babies, children, young people, and their families. The Network includes the following health services:
- Women’s and Children’s Hospital: South Australia’s specialist paediatric hospital and largest maternity and obstetric service
- Child and Adolescent Mental Health Service
- Aboriginal Health Division
- Child and Family Health Service
- Child Protection Service
- Children’s Disability Services
- Metropolitan Youth Health Service
- Cedar Health Service
- Yarrow Place Rape and Sexual Assault Service
